Transaction 5c63830a8fe0bf5cd025ea83626763da1c2294d2ca95935bd395f572af54f7db
1 Input
1 Output
-
5c63830a8fe0bf5cd025ea83626763da1c2294d2ca95935bd395f572af54f7db:0
- value
- 1676257
- script pubkey
- OP_0 OP_PUSHBYTES_20 628bc19fcc339460df083993c90c7c3e86384309
- address
- bc1qv29ur87vxw2xphcg8xfujrru86rrsscf05rs4j